Jim Lambie

The Fruitmarket Gallery presents a solo exhibition of the work of Jim Lambie, one of Scotland's most internationally significant artists. Known for visually compelling, generous and beguiling work which attracts both popular and critical acclaim, Lambie came to prominence with Zobop (1999), a floor-based sculptural intervention that consists of continuous lines of multi-coloured vinyl tape laid in concentric circuits of a room from its outside edges to its centre.

Lambie's work makes its magic from relatively humble materials – tinfoil and coat hangers, jackets, mirrors, records, turntables, potato sacks, plastic bags and household paint. Bringing together early sculptures including The Kid with the Replaceable Head (1996), Ultralow (1998/2007), Stakka (1999), Roadie (1999) and Zobop (1999), with more recent work including a spectacular new version of Shaved Ice (2012/14) that fills the ground floor of the Gallery with a forest of floor-to-ceiling, brightly-coloured mirrored ladders, this exhibition offers the opportunity to trace the development of Lambie's exuberantly intelligent and visually arresting sculptural language.
